초록

The purpose of this study is to measure the changes of regional cerebral blood flow (rCBF) and blood pressure (BP) of Cortex Acanthopanacis in rats, and to determine the effect of Cortex Acanthopanacis on phenylephrine (PE) induced contraction of isolated rat thoracic aorta. The measurement was continually monitored by laser-doppler flowmeter (Transonic Instrument, USA) and pressure transducer (Grass, USA) in anesthetized adult Sprague-Dawley rats through the data acquisition system composed of MacLab and Macintosh computer. Contractile force was measured with force displacement transducer under 1.5 g loading tension. The result of this experiment was as following; 1. Cortex Acanthopanacis did not effect the changes of rCBF and blood pressure significantly. 2. Contractions evoked by phenylephrine were decreased significantly by Cortex Acanthopanacis 3. L-NNA, ODQ, atropine and indomethacin significantly altered the relaxation of Cortex Acanthopanacis. 4. Propranolol did not change the relaxation of Cortex Acanthopanacis. These results indicate that Cortex Acanthopanacis did not change the rCBF and BP, but Cortex Acanthopanacis can relax PE induced contraction of isolated rat thoracic aorta and that this increasing contraction related to endothelium and various mechanism.
